Author Guidelines

GUIDE FOR AUTHORS

For the preparation of manuscripts, the journal requires that bibliographic references follow the criteria of the American Psychological Association (APA). The required font is Arial 12, 1.5 line spacing, on A4 pages.

 

Only original and unpublished manuscripts that have not been published in other scientific journals will be accepted. All articles will be submitted to external reviewers under a double-blind peer review system (the anonymity of both reviewers and authors is preserved).

 

The Review Committee reserves the right to accept, accept with revisions, or reject the submitted manuscript based on compliance with the established guidelines. The criteria and positions expressed in each article are the sole responsibility of the authors.

 

SECTIONS

1– EDITORIAL

A space for reflection on the themes addressed in each issue of the journal. It is intended for invited authors to contribute different perspectives on current issues.

Type of submission: By invitation only from the Editorial Board.

Length: minimum 2 pages, maximum 6 pages.

2– SCIENTIFIC ARTICLES

Submission requirements

1– Original and unpublished scientific articles will be accepted.

2– Page 1 must include: title, surname(s) of the author(s), institutional affiliation, abstract of 150 to 300 words (in Spanish and English), and 3 keywords.

3– Main text: minimum length 10 pages, maximum length 20 pages.

3– REFLECTIONS ON PROFESSIONAL PRACTICE

This section presents experiences related to professional practice, developed jointly by faculty members and students. It includes evaluation reports of university outreach activities, as well as relevant works developed from a research perspective within course settings.

Type of submission: Open; interdisciplinary and cross-course contributions are especially encouraged.

Submission requirements

1– Only unpublished manuscripts will be accepted.

3– The submission must include a title.

4– Main text: minimum length 5 pages, maximum length 8 pages.

4– DEBATE

This section includes selected articles to be discussed by authors from different institutions. Their comments and/or critiques will be followed by a response from the author of the main article.

Type of submission: By invitation from the Editorial Board.

Submission requirements

1– Only unpublished manuscripts will be accepted.

3– The submission must include a title with a maximum length of 15 words.

4– Main text: minimum length 5 pages, maximum length 8 pages.

5– INTERSTICIOS IN ACTION

Submissions in this section focus on problems and objects of study related to the social sciences and humanities. Dialogue between disciplines is encouraged as a way to address current issues. Through this section, the journal’s distinctive orientation promotes the analysis of interstices from an interdisciplinary perspective.

Type of submission: By invitation from the Editorial Board.

Submission requirements

1– Only unpublished manuscripts will be accepted.

2– The submission must include a title, the author’s name, and the institutional affiliation of the author.

4– Main text: minimum length 5 pages, maximum length 8 pages.

6– THESIS OR FINAL INTEGRATION PROJECT (UNDERGRADUATE OR POSTGRADUATE)

This section is intended for final projects by undergraduate or postgraduate students who, through an original research process, have successfully addressed a research problem. For publication, the topic, problem statement, objectives, hypotheses/conceptual categories, methodology, and findings will be considered.

Type of submission: Open.

Submission requirements

1– Only unpublished manuscripts will be accepted.

2– Font: Arial 12, 1.5 line spacing, on A4 pages.

3– Page 1 must include: title, surname(s) of the author(s), institutional affiliation, abstract of 150 to 300 words (in Spanish and English), and 3 keywords.

4– Main text: minimum length 5 pages, maximum length 10 pages.

7– BOOK REVIEWS

Book reviews should address recent publications (or works of relevance to the field) and provide a brief, critical description of the content. The aim is to inform the academic community about relevant scholarly works.

A high-resolution image of the book cover must be submitted along with the manuscript.

Type of submission: Open.

Submission requirements

1– Only unpublished manuscripts will be accepted.

2– The submission must include the title of the book, the author, and the year of publication.

3– Main text: minimum length 5 pages, maximum length 8 pages.
